The Nose Bought $100,000 Worth Of Anthony Fauci Bobbleheads

Home Box Office
John Turturro in HBO's 'The Plot Against America.'

We've entered a moment where the director of the National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ases is a celebrity. You can buy donuts with his face on them. A petition to make him People's Sexiest Man Alive has more than 13,000 signatures. And, yes, sales of Dr. Anthony Fauci bobblehead dolls have raised more than $100,000.

At the same time, how do we find community in this time of COVID and quarantine and social distance?

And then: The Plot Against America is HBO's miniseries based on Philip Roth's novel. It's an alternative history written 16 years ago -- and set 80 years ago -- with undeniable echos of our present politics.
